Skip to main content

Enable advanced processing for multibeam and singlebeam echosounder data.THIS PROJECT IS IN DEVELOPMENT.

Project description

Hi there

themachinethatgoesping (tmtgp or p!ng) is about to become a set Python libraries for enabling advanced processing strategies for multibeam and singlebeam echosounder data.
Our approach is to implement core components of this library in C++ and create python interfaces using pybind11.
The functionality of the c++ core components will thus also be accessibly both, from C++ and Python.
However, many libraries, tools and applications will be implemented in Python directly, making use of the fast prototyping features of this language.

Most of the libraries will be released using the Mozilla Public License 2.0 (MPL 2.0) which implements a non-infecting copyleft on file basis. It should thus be compatible with proprietary applications, with GPL >2.0 but also MIT and BSD projects (if the license of the files is not changes). More detailed information will follow soon.

We just started with he development, so don't expect to many useful features yet. If you are interested, contact peter.urban@ugent.be

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

themachinethatgoesping-0.26.3-cp312-cp312-win_amd64.whl (10.4 MB view details)

Uploaded CPython 3.12Windows x86-64

themachinethatgoesping-0.26.3-cp312-cp312-manylinux_2_28_x86_64.whl (15.8 MB view details)

Uploaded CPython 3.12manylinux: glibc 2.28+ x86-64

themachinethatgoesping-0.26.3-cp312-cp312-macosx_14_0_arm64.whl (12.7 MB view details)

Uploaded CPython 3.12macOS 14.0+ ARM64

themachinethatgoesping-0.26.3-cp311-cp311-win_amd64.whl (10.4 MB view details)

Uploaded CPython 3.11Windows x86-64

themachinethatgoesping-0.26.3-cp311-cp311-manylinux_2_28_x86_64.whl (15.9 MB view details)

Uploaded CPython 3.11manylinux: glibc 2.28+ x86-64

themachinethatgoesping-0.26.3-cp311-cp311-macosx_14_0_arm64.whl (12.5 MB view details)

Uploaded CPython 3.11macOS 14.0+ ARM64

themachinethatgoesping-0.26.3-cp310-cp310-win_amd64.whl (10.4 MB view details)

Uploaded CPython 3.10Windows x86-64

themachinethatgoesping-0.26.3-cp310-cp310-manylinux_2_28_x86_64.whl (15.8 MB view details)

Uploaded CPython 3.10manylinux: glibc 2.28+ x86-64

themachinethatgoesping-0.26.3-cp310-cp310-macosx_14_0_arm64.whl (12.5 MB view details)

Uploaded CPython 3.10macOS 14.0+ ARM64

File details

Details for the file themachinethatgoesping-0.26.3-cp312-cp312-win_amd64.whl.

File metadata

File hashes

Hashes for themachinethatgoesping-0.26.3-cp312-cp312-win_amd64.whl
Algorithm Hash digest
SHA256 d82833d9775730b981ee44490c1f2fb44243586ba82ce33ddfe8a17349880c4e
MD5 adc4c2da9c4d2a262bcd4ee2da0a4928
BLAKE2b-256 98644a1c33428a1aa812ed5258097d86071de9fb9f63e4d7f0ac3a0e69ad9751

See more details on using hashes here.

File details

Details for the file themachinethatgoesping-0.26.3-cp312-cp312-man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for themachinethatgoesping-0.26.3-cp312-cp312-man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 8b3261fe2a11f2772752caac1108012e555202044a586de6e465cab8b08cf5c7
MD5 dc6bece6cdcc8971a991b61a537aa2fa
BLAKE2b-256 fe9378632f611406e2da735d708de96e3e0d331711e8fe0b320a211e10a44540

See more details on using hashes here.

File details

Details for the file themachinethatgoesping-0.26.3-cp312-cp312-macosx_14_0_arm64.whl.

File metadata

File hashes

Hashes for themachinethatgoesping-0.26.3-cp312-cp312-macosx_14_0_arm64.whl
Algorithm Hash digest
SHA256 37092d28169fc2822ccbd1140ec0cfcfbad6f638004d88217cfa55e3bd3a0c4e
MD5 1f000eaea126fb00d03bc43647925d01
BLAKE2b-256 fee743e9fb32ae8958cefd832cbaf801b207cdd23fc964a1d008f7e6dd0af8b3

See more details on using hashes here.

File details

Details for the file themachinethatgoesping-0.26.3-cp311-cp311-win_amd64.whl.

File metadata

File hashes

Hashes for themachinethatgoesping-0.26.3-cp311-cp311-win_amd64.whl
Algorithm Hash digest
SHA256 913af84d2a7dcb7c43d6cf3f00493702214a03b177cacc00c99115b929da532d
MD5 e39933fce0f3b497f51b3f2e7d1c4f03
BLAKE2b-256 5f13985878b2a26b14b638e4c3a831be2272904783174c5093d6f562fb98adf8

See more details on using hashes here.

File details

Details for the file themachinethatgoesping-0.26.3-cp311-cp311-man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for themachinethatgoesping-0.26.3-cp311-cp311-man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 f8f51c3d93e5c101b70ebdc7b4fb356ccb4322270afbd13c3309103d2b7a9176
MD5 6b5576c7a45d173bb7263cc658e71bff
BLAKE2b-256 01e757f78381b0e69e9fd005c687ed1a23a3a16361234db97866fa85bebbb3d9

See more details on using hashes here.

File details

Details for the file themachinethatgoesping-0.26.3-cp311-cp311-macosx_14_0_arm64.whl.

File metadata

File hashes

Hashes for themachinethatgoesping-0.26.3-cp311-cp311-macosx_14_0_arm64.whl
Algorithm Hash digest
SHA256 6f541788502206f72ce1670557a6aaad3b634a7e8c8be4aea8a61cd30dbd752d
MD5 9717597eec44516fe67cdce8da1e41d7
BLAKE2b-256 f74e77bdc9a50a184db0d47d1e20f8a9199e3edcd01a840b978f24b61188bb95

See more details on using hashes here.

File details

Details for the file themachinethatgoesping-0.26.3-cp310-cp310-win_amd64.whl.

File metadata

File hashes

Hashes for themachinethatgoesping-0.26.3-cp310-cp310-win_amd64.whl
Algorithm Hash digest
SHA256 e223f6573075ed8a6e30d0e7024a3acf414b4ff29455c9b1f13f22bbe5e42e30
MD5 437552530c2e04348bc9433a48924ccb
BLAKE2b-256 2357ca7fa9d9388c22e2fd4ed63bf983fe96776ae8d83feb7d3d7b92796f4359

See more details on using hashes here.

File details

Details for the file themachinethatgoesping-0.26.3-cp310-cp310-man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for themachinethatgoesping-0.26.3-cp310-cp310-man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 bc0195efc65c66f3e236b8db8cddc2bec9ebef4b0eec2a536c82fdaa1ec93158
MD5 67aba1a80aab7b880741d033db684f72
BLAKE2b-256 ba381a3c873bc8541e6450ce88dfe5b0d9f1c787e504eaae4931a1b1d22f4ca0

See more details on using hashes here.

File details

Details for the file themachinethatgoesping-0.26.3-cp310-cp310-macosx_14_0_arm64.whl.

File metadata

File hashes

Hashes for themachinethatgoesping-0.26.3-cp310-cp310-macosx_14_0_arm64.whl
Algorithm Hash digest
SHA256 06056e4d61326b77ecaf6422bd1ffed3f6384767ffde497cbfb51318f7b0390f
MD5 d16592280ae8850da6fdff0ba98f80db
BLAKE2b-256 3d3b85b5bee1bdeda271807f77e45752109fc4593859ac986da4506dd29b8669

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page